[RadioShabelle] The US-Somali cop accused of fatally shooting an Australian woman outside her home had brandished his gun on a driver during a traffic stop months earlier, it has been revealed.

Dashcam footage has emerged showing former Minneapolis police officer Mohammed Noor, 33, pointing his weapon at a driver after he had stopped him for allegedly not using his turn signal in May 2017.

Noor has been charged with second-degree intentional murder, third-degree murder and second-degree manslaughter for allegedly gunning down life coach Justine Ruszczyk Damond, 40, after she called 911 to report a possible sexual assault behind her home in July 2017. Ms Damond, who was originally from Sydney, rushed outside in her pyjamas to meet officers when Noor opened fire.
